Who We Are
CR Sustainability, Inc. provides large-scale environmental and janitorial services for stadiums, arenas, and other major venues across multiple states. Our teams support zero-waste initiatives by sorting waste to divert recyclables and compostables from landfills, helping venues meet their sustainability goals while maintaining a clean, safe, and guest-ready environment.

The Role

  • The Lead Recruiter plays a key role in ensuring CR Sustainability has the workforce needed to support venue and event operations nationwide. This position focuses primarily on high-volume recruiting for field team members while also supporting occasional hiring for administrative roles.
  • This role is responsible for building the recruiting infrastructure for CR Sustainability, including hiring metrics, recruiting workflows, and scalable hiring processes that support the company’s continued growth. The ideal candidate is a self-starter who is comfortable creating structure where systems do not yet exist and managing recruiting efforts in a fast-paced, high-volume environment.

Duties

  • Lead recruiting efforts for field positions across multiple venues and states, with a primary focus on high-volume hiring for event and venue operations.
  • Design and implement recruiting systems that allow CR Sustainability to scale hiring across multiple markets and large staffing events.
  • Build and maintain recruiting pipelines for field positions to ensure consistent candidate flow ahead of operational staffing needs.
  • Develop and maintain recruiting dashboards and tracking tools to monitor hiring activity and workforce readiness.
  • Establish and track key recruiting metrics including Time to Fill, Time to Hire, Cost per Hire, Source of Hire, Applicant Conversion Rate, Offer Acceptance Rate, New Hire Show Rate, and 30-Day Retention.
  • Analyze recruiting data and hiring trends to identify pipeline gaps, staffing risks, or process inefficiencies.
  • Partner with operations leadership to forecast staffing needs for upcoming events, new venues, and ongoing service operations.
  • Post and maintain job advertisements across recruiting platforms and ensure job postings remain accurate, competitive, and aligned with operational needs.
  • Review applications and conduct initial candidate screenings to assess qualifications, availability, and suitability for field roles.
  • Coordinate interviews with site supervisors and hiring managers while ensuring efficient movement of candidates through the hiring pipeline.
  • Manage large-scale recruiting efforts associated with new venue launches, major events, or seasonal staffing increases.
  • Develop standardized recruiting processes and tools that support consistent hiring practices across locations.
  • Initiate onboarding documentation and monitor completion through digital onboarding systems such as DocuSign.
  • Submit and track background checks, employment verifications, and other pre-employment requirements where applicable.
  • Process and manage E-Verify cases where required and ensure employment eligibility documentation is completed accurately.
  • Coordinate closely with operations teams to confirm start dates, assignments, and readiness for new hires prior to their first shift.
  • Enter new employee information into payroll and HR systems and ensure all employee records are accurate and compliant.
  • Maintain organized employee documentation and ensure records are complete and audit-ready.
  • Communicate clearly with candidates, supervisors, and internal teams regarding hiring status, onboarding progress, and staffing updates.
  • Leverage AI resources/software to increase efficiencies, streamline processes and maximize existing resources.
  • Continuously identify opportunities to improve recruiting efficiency, candidate experience, and hiring outcomes as the organization grows.
